Why RAM is Essential for PC Performance
RAM enables your CPU to access data quickly, allowing your system to load applications, manage multitasking, and handle demanding tasks efficiently. The amount and type of RAM in your system will directly impact its speed, responsiveness, and capability to run multiple programs simultaneously.
Key Functions of RAM:
- Faster Data Access: RAM stores data that the CPU frequently uses, minimizing access times compared to storage drives.
- Improves Multitasking: More RAM allows for more simultaneous applications, crucial for productivity.
- Affects Gaming Performance: RAM speed and size can impact loading times, FPS, and overall gameplay smoothness.
- Essential for Content Creation: Tasks like video editing, graphic design, and 3D rendering require substantial RAM to handle large files and heavy processing.
Key Factors to Consider When Choosing RAM
Understanding a few key specifications can help you make an informed decision when selecting RAM for your system:
- Capacity (GB): The amount of RAM determines how much data can be stored for quick access. Entry-level systems generally need at least 8GB, while gaming and professional work benefit from 16GB, 32GB, or more.
- Speed (MHz): RAM speed, measured in MHz, indicates how quickly data can be read and written. Faster speeds improve performance, especially in gaming and heavy applications.
- Form Factor (DIMM vs. SO-DIMM): Standard desktops use DIMM modules, while laptops and compact systems use SO-DIMM.
- DDR Generation: DDR4 and DDR5 are the most common standards. DDR5 offers higher speeds and efficiency but requires a compatible motherboard.
- Latency (CL): CAS Latency (CL) represents the delay before data starts to be read. Lower CL numbers are preferable for faster response times.
- Compatibility: Ensure that the RAM is compatible with your motherboard and CPU in terms of speed, capacity, and type (e.g., DDR4 or DDR5).

1. RAM for Basic Use and Everyday Computing
- Recommended Capacity: 8GB
- Suggested Speed: 2400-2666 MHz (DDR4)
- Best For: Web browsing, office work, and light applications
- Top Brands: Crucial, Kingston, TeamGroup, Corsair

2. RAM for Gaming
- Recommended Capacity: 16GB or 32GB
- Suggested Speed: 3000-3600 MHz (DDR4) or 4800 MHz+ (DDR5)
- Best For: Gaming at high settings, supporting game performance and multitasking
- Top Brands: Corsair, G.Skill, Kingston, HyperX

3. RAM for Content Creation and Professional Work
- Recommended Capacity: 32GB, 64GB, or more
- Suggested Speed: 3200-4000 MHz (DDR4) or 5600 MHz+ (DDR5)
- Best For: Video editing, graphic design, 3D modeling, and multitasking
- Top Brands: Corsair, G.Skill, Crucial, TeamGroup

4. High-Performance RAM for Overclocking and Enthusiasts
- Recommended Capacity: 32GB or 64GB
- Suggested Speed: 4000 MHz+ (DDR4) or 6000 MHz+ (DDR5)
- Best For: High-end gaming, overclocking, and professional workloads
- Top Brands: G.Skill, Corsair, Kingston

Tips for Optimizing RAM Performance
- Enable XMP Profiles: XMP profiles allow RAM to run at its rated speed rather than default settings, which can enhance performance.
- Choose Dual or Quad Channel: Installing RAM in pairs (dual-channel) or sets of four (quad-channel) can increase data transfer speeds.
- Consider Future Upgrades: If you anticipate needing more RAM in the future, make sure to choose a motherboard with enough slots.
Frequently Asked Questions (FAQs)
Q: How much RAM do I need for gaming?
A: 16GB is ideal for most modern games. For future-proofing and multitasking, 32GB is recommended.
Q: What is the difference between DDR4 and DDR5?
A: DDR5 offers higher speeds and efficiency compared to DDR4 but requires compatible motherboards and CPUs.
Q: Can I mix RAM sizes or brands?
A: Mixing RAM is possible but not recommended, as it can lead to stability issues. For best performance, use identical RAM kits.
Q: Is faster RAM always better?
A: Higher RAM speeds benefit specific tasks like gaming and content creation, but the difference may be minimal in general use. Make sure your motherboard supports the RAM speed you choose.
